The MKR WiFi 1010 does have a watchdog timer, it just doesn't use the avr/wdt.h library (because it's not AVR). You can force a reset by enabling the watchdog timer and then letting it time out, just as you would do on an AVR. When searching for information for the MKR WiFi 1010, it can actually be better to use the search term "Zero" instead. The Arduino Zero uses the same ATSAMD21G18 microcontroller as the MKR WiFi 1010 so most information will apply to either (excluding information related to the additional accessories on either board), but the Zero has been around much longer than the MKR WiFi 1010 so there is more information on it.

reset: NVIC_SystemReset();

watchdog: GitHub - adafruit/Adafruit_SleepyDog: Arduino library to use the watchdog timer for system reset and low power sleep.
